#bda4f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bda4f0 is composed of 74.1% red, 64.3%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.3% cyan, 31.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 259.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 79.2%. #bda4f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7b49e1.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

● #bda4f0 color description : Very soft violet.
#bda4f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bda4f0 has RGB values of R:189, G:164,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 12428528.

Shades and Tints of #bda4f0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04020a is the darkest color, while #faf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bda4f0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cac9cb is the less saturated color, while #b998fc is the most saturated one.
